Block

#21,063,708
Block Number
21,063,708 @ 03/05/2025, 09:13:50
Status
Finalized
ID
0x0141681c4593ca16ce8e8e25bf5f229ef9c4b3df715bd911fab297c3d9c2ee62
Transactions
Gas Used
8108285/40000000 (20.27% Used)
Total Score
2,056,504,029 (+98)
Rewards
30.02 VTHO